Most Catholics know, at least intuitively when the collection basket is passed every Sunday, that they should give to the Church. What often remains unclear, however, is if there is a binding obligation to do so. Is giving to the Church like giving to a secular charity such as the Red Cross? And if Catholics have a duty to give, how much? Should they tithe (i.e., give 10% of their earnings) as Christians did in times past or rely on another metric altogether?
